🤖AI Summary

Grayscale Investments has released a research report positioning Hyperliquid as a breakout success story in crypto derivatives, citing its $800 million annualized 2025 revenue, fully on-chain model, and institutional-grade performance. Grayscale has also filed an S-1 registration for a proposed Hyperliquid ETF, marking significant institutional validation for the platform.

Analysis

Grayscale's endorsement represents a watershed moment for institutional recognition in crypto derivatives infrastructure. The report's focus on Hyperliquid's $800 million revenue—a tangible metric rather than speculative valuations—suggests the platform has achieved genuine product-market fit in a traditionally centralized space. This validation carries weight because Grayscale operates under SEC scrutiny for all products, making their research more credible than typical market commentary.

Hyperliquid's dual-layer approach merits examination: it combines DeFi's foundational principles of transparency and self-custody with centralized exchange-level performance and user experience. This hybrid model addresses a persistent crypto market inefficiency where users historically faced binary choices between decentralization and usability. The platform's expansion beyond perpetuals into spot trading, commodities, and outcome markets indicates it's positioning itself as infrastructure, not merely a trading venue.

The SEC-pending ETF filing transforms the narrative from niche crypto interest to potential mainstream adoption. An approved Hyperliquid ETF would expose institutional capital flows to the platform's success, though approval remains uncertain. Grayscale's emphasis on Hyperliquid's revenue being small relative to traditional derivatives markets ($800 million versus trillions globally) reveals realistic assessment—significant growth remains available if execution continues.

The critical question for market participants involves regulatory trajectory. Favorable SEC treatment of crypto infrastructure could accelerate adoption curves, while regulatory headwinds could constrain growth. Hyperliquid's continued ability to balance decentralization principles with institutional-grade infrastructure will determine whether this becomes a foundational financial layer or a prominent niche player.
